Description
'Perfect for our time' Adrian Searle, Guardian
An extraordinary collection of powerfully inspiring imagery on the nature of challenge and change. Features 240 reproductions of art, photography and objects, selected from cultures through history and across the globe, including works by living artists: Zanele Muholi, Kara Walker, Carrie Mae Weems, Ellen Gallagher, Shirin Neshat, Gillian Wearing and many others.

Author's Bio
Stephen Ellcock is a curator who has expanded his Facebook page and Instagram feed into an online museum of images, visual delights, oddities and wonders drawn from every conceivable culture, era and corner of the globe. He is the author several books, including All Good Things and The Book of Change.
